Grasshopper3 is the first camera to offer 9.1MP CCD on USB 3.0

Point Grey have today announced the introduction of the new Grasshopper3 camera featuring the highest resolution, global shutter CCD sensors with a USB 3.0 interface currently available on the market. The new Grasshopper3 GS3-U3-91S6 camera models are based on colour and monochrome versions of Sony ICX814, a 1" CCD featuring 3.69 micron square pixels (Sony's highest resolution CCD to date). The camera outputs 3376 x 2704 images at 9 fps using monochrome, raw or colour interpolated pixel formats.

Improving quantum efficiency, reducing smear, and increasing sensitivity, including into the near infrared, the ICX814 global shutter sensor uses EXview HAD CCD II technology—a further evolved version of the well-known EXview HAD CCD technology. In order to increase the maximum frame rate, the sensor is capable of single tap readout for extended shutter, high gain imaging and multi-tap readout. The GS3-U3-91S6 camera allows users to toggle between single and dual tap sensor readout and address both imaging conditions.

Michael Gibbons, Director of Sales and Marketing, commented: "The GS3-U3-91S6 model is the highest resolution global shutter CCD with a USB 3.0 interface on the market. The camera offers a very compact mechanical design and competitive price point when compared to similar products with GigE or Camera Link interfaces. Excellent quantum efficiency, low temporal dark noise, and high dynamic range make this product suitable for a wide range of applications, including flat panel inspection, 3D measurement, ophthalmology, flow-scanning cytometry, and fluorescence imaging."

Offering optimal performance and reliability, the Grasshopper3 uses a proprietary USB 3.0 link layer and frame buffer-based architecture like all Point Grey USB 3.0 cameras. The Grasshopper3 uses an advanced image processing pipeline to enable colour interpolation, look up table, gamma correction and pixel binning.

The Grasshopper3 GS3-U3-91S6 colour and monochrome models are list priced at USD $3695 and EUR €2845 and are available to order now from Point Grey and its distributor network. Additional Grasshopper3 models featuring a 4.1 megapixel global shutter CMOS device will be released in Q3 2013.
